## Runbook: RateMatch Parity Checker Release

Before promoting a RateMatch build, run the parity sweep against the Harlow staging feed. Expect under 0.5% mismatch; anything higher means the scraper schemas drifted — halt the release. If the sweep passes, tag the artifact and notify the channel. Record the promoted build's token, which appears directly below.

build token for kagaf-hahof: htk14_9d3d4d26d7d8de

# Break-Glass: Catalog Cache Invalidation

Scope: the Pinrow product catalog at Veldstone Retail. If stale prices persist after a purge and the Hollowmere invalidation queue is wedged, use break-glass to flush the edge tier directly. Contractors: get verbal sign-off from the catalog lead first. Steps: open the Hollowmere admin shell, select emergency-flush, confirm the tenant, and run it once — repeated flushes thrash the origin. Access is logged and expires after 20 minutes. Unseal the admin shell with the passphrase below.

recovery phrase for kahop-tajog: istix-casvan

## Local Setup — Payroll Export v3

Support team: the Ledgerwing payroll export switched from fixed-width to delimited format in v3. Old parsers will fail silently — always check the header row. To reproduce customer issues locally:

1. Install the Ledgerwing CLI (v3.2+).
2. Run `lw export --format v3 --dry-run` against the sandbox tenant.
3. Compare output to the customer's file; column order matters.

Exports older than v3 need the legacy flag. The sandbox tenant seeds itself from the export database, reachable via the following.

replica DSN, kajep-yahag: mssql://praok_svc:iF@db-8d68.plorvaio.local:5432/eliion